Anthony Kim: A Golfing Prodigy and His Impact on the Sport

Before delving deeper into the discussions around appearance, let's recap Anthony Kim's significant contributions to golf. He burst onto the scene in the mid-2000s, captivating golf fans with his youthful exuberance, explosive power, and fearlessness on the course. He quickly rose through the ranks, earning his first PGA Tour victory in 2008 at the Wachovia Championship, where he defeated a field of seasoned professionals, showing his ability to perform under pressure. His dynamic style of play, which included aggressive driving and exceptional iron play, stood out in a sport often characterized by precision and strategic approaches.

Kim's performance at the 2008 Ryder Cup was a highlight of his career. He played with extraordinary confidence, going 2-0-1. He was a key player in the U.S. team's victory. He became a symbol of American golf for his passion, determination, and exciting shots. His popularity also soared because he was a young, charismatic athlete who brought a new energy to the game. His style and competitive spirit made golf much more interesting for the younger fans.

The rapid ascent of Anthony Kim seemed poised to solidify him as a top golfer for years to come, but injuries and personal decisions led to his sudden retirement from professional golf in 2012 at the young age of 26. The Unexpected Retirement and Its Aftermath

Anthony Kim's decision to retire from professional golf at the age of 26 was a significant shock to the sport. Injuries, including issues with his wrist and Achilles, played a huge part, but the story's specifics have remained somewhat obscure. The combination of physical limitations and personal reasons prompted his early retirement, creating a situation where speculation about his future and what he would do began.
